Captains Of Industry

is a loosely connected organisation of like-minded writers, musicians, artists, poets, publishers, record labels, producers, fanzines and other deviants of the artistic / altruistic process. Through a simple shared philosophy the collective aims to share resources and provide cross-cultural reference points in order to aid creative output and spread a message of opposition to those who misuse their positions of power - be they artistic, economic or political.

D. Ferris – kit
J. Hale – bass
J. Maiden – guitar
P. Spiby – guitar / voice


“…It’s a shame, as everyone knows the Devil’s got the best tunes..”  Bono, U2.

Indeed he does……..

Or maybe its Future eX Wife that have all the best tunes.

Featuring ex-Dogdrill frontman/guitarist Pete Spiby it may be hard not to think on first impressions that this band will be pulling influence from a very dark place, as everyone knows, the Dogdrill sound came directly from the Devils fingertips, why would this be any different. Well, it just is and all the better for it.

Future eX Wife no longer count on the dark lord for guidance, as he’s too busy burning the bridges of current scenesters, instead they have stolen the devils own back catalogue and spat in his eye on the way out. They are, in their own words ….  ‘Big Dumb Ass Rockpunk’…..who write songs dedicated to  their favourite lap dancers. The music is pretty sexy, so why not write about sexy ladies?”
Why not?

Legendary photographer and founder of carelesstalkcostslives magazine Steve Gullick on first hearing them exclaimed “…… they rock like trucker speed freak crack whores with scabies and bursting piles, I want them in the magazine....”

This led to the band getting their first bit of real press and a chance for
someone to tell it like it is. Ben Myers wrote about them for the issue  “… with Future eX Wife, if you know. You know. You feel it.…. the sound of sexy Sabbath, battered by the dynamics of great early Nineties bands like Unsane , the Jesus Lizard and Helmet….Riffs tumble like anvils down an up elevator. It drips with cool.”

When asked to describe a live show their own description is this …..
 “ like being locked inside a strongbox with a heart-eating virus.”

So, Rock history in the making, as ‘The Wife’ have been getting spot plays from the album on Radio One over the last 4 weeks, on both John Peels show and the rockshow, where Editor –in-Chief at Kerrang! Phil Alexander, described them as ‘an awesome new band’
They are also endorsed by the rock shows producer Emma Lyne and presenter Mary-Anne Hobbs, who added  “… sounds of the great Zeppelin come to mind, you’ll be hearing more from them in the near future…. Future eX Wife are one of our new favourite bands of the season. Everyone here at Radio One are behind them
110%”

‘Miss September’ was seven songs, of bile, recorded in seven hours. Sheffield, England. One hot summer day in July 2003. Raw. Bloody. No frills. As it’s meant to be.


Fresh from a UK tour and a blistering South By South West appearance, steely-eyed blues rockers Future eX Wife then released the world’s first micro-album, ‘While Your Husband’s Away…’

A perfectly-executed exercise in muscular rock n’ roll ‘While Your Husband’s Away…’ has spawned the revolutionary new format: the ‘micro-album’. Within are five songs carved from granite, dusted in glitter and doused in petrol. Think Sabbath – Soundgarden – Shellac.
